Job Summary

Covenant Health is seeking a Director of Cybersecurity to lead cybersecurity operations and strategy across the organization. This role ensures the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of sensitive data, including protected health information (PHI). The Director sets the vision for cybersecurity services, manages technical projects, oversees compliance with HIPAA and other regulations, and leads a team of cybersecurity professionals.
